There is much that can be seen in the winter that cannot be seen during the
dog days of summer. Though it has been a very cold and snowy winter so
far, with the cold come a rare, beautiful and unique view of the ocean. In
the Picture above will you see what looks like steam rising off the ocean.
This is known as sea smoke and can be seen in extreme cold temperatures.

We have lost two members of our Wells Beach family this past month here at Lafayette’s Oceanfront Resort at Wells Beach.
Jennifer Joy Small was a housekeeper who has worked here during summers since 1998. She was a wife to Ivan, a mother of three children, all of whom she was able to see through college, and a friend to all of us here at Wells Beach. She was a hard worker and many of our guests have asked about her during the past few years when we were not able to get a visa for her to come back. We will all miss her.
Sharon Bayko was the head housekeeper here for many years. She has been battling cancer for the past several years. She was able to work throughout her struggles with cancer and showed us her strength of character and what a determined person can accomplish. She was a wonderful person who was a wife and a caretaker her husband Nicholas until his death last year. She was also the proud mother of three children and grandmother to seven. She was a strong leader in our housekeeping department and she has helped this property grow. She never wavered in her commitment to the high standards that she felt the property and the associate here were able to achieve. We will all miss her.
